How the amount is determined for health insurance?

Answer: Generally, your total cost is your premium + deductible + out-of-pocket costs + any copayments/coinsurance. ... When you preview plans at HealthCare.gov, you'll see an estimate of your total costs, but your actual expenses will likely vary.
